Minke whales are commonly seen along the Ribbon Reefs north of Cairns, Australia, between May and August. Mike Ball Expeditions conducts Minke Whale Expeditions with the entire second day devoted to finding and diving with these special cetaceans.

Since 1996, their usual hang-out areas have been discovered. A protocol with minimal impact on the whales has slowly developed allowing the whales to approach divers within their own comfort level. That and the Minke’s natural curiosity allow for personal encounters and spectacular opportunities for close up videos and phenomenal photography.
